Company Overview

JCI’s market capitalization of 70.22 billion USD is significantly greater than ATI’s 12.25 billion USD, highlighting its more substantial market valuation.

With betas of 1.13 for ATI and 1.34 for JCI, both stocks show similar sensitivity to overall market movements.
